Frequently asked questions about Gower West Elem School

How many students attend Gower West Elem School?

Gower West Elem School has 531 students enrolled. It is a public school in Willowbrook, IL. CCD year-over-year: 549 (2022-23) → 528 (2023-24), nearly flat (-21).

What is the student-teacher ratio at Gower West Elem School?

The student-teacher ratio at Gower West Elem School is 14.4:1, which is 3% higher than the Illinois average of 14:1 and 8% lower than the national average of 15.7:1.

What is the racial and ethnic makeup of Gower West Elem School?

The largest demographic group at Gower West Elem School is White at 59.7% of enrollment, in Willowbrook, IL. Its student body is more racially and ethnically mixed than most US schools, with a diversity index of 59.6/100.

What is the Resource Investment Index for Gower West Elem School?

Gower West Elem School has a Resource Investment Index of 41/100 (typical reported resources relative to schools nationally) based on 4 factors: student-teacher ratio, gifted-program reporting, counselor availability, chronic absenteeism. Not a test-score or academic measure (national median ~41/100, see methodology).

How does Gower West Elem School rank among public schools in Willowbrook?

By Resource Investment Index, Gower West Elem School ranks #2 of 3 public schools in Willowbrook, IL. This compares federal resource and staffing data among local peers; it is not a test-score or academic ranking.
